In August, the Avalanche Collective research team will descend into the muggy terrain of Athens Georgia to create an exhibition at the University of Georgia’s Broad Street Gallery, located at 257 W. Broad St. in downtown Athens.
Seeking shelter within the Dow Jones Mountain Range , the group will explore the physical and virtual habitats of
the city . Avalanche Collective looks to the wilderness of the internet landscape while appropriating the modes and
language of 19th century arctic explorers. They will present their findings in the form of a multimedia sculptural
installation including a multi-channel audio performance during the opening on August 10th, 2007 from 7-10pm.
